    Who is Dr. Al-Kabbani, Neurologist in Knoxville, TN?

    Dr. Samir Al-Kabbani, MD is a Neurologist, who primarily practices in Knoxville, TN with 1 additional practice location. He is board certified. Dr. Al-Kabbani graduated from University of Damascus / Faculty of Medicine and completed his residency at Wake Forest University Baptist Medical Center Program. Dr. Al-Kabbani is fluent in English and German, and is currently seeing new patients. Dr. Al-Kabbani’s practice accepts Medicare, UnitedHealthcare and other major insurance plans.     A neuropathologist is expert in the diagnosis of diseases of the nervous system and skeletal muscles and functions as a consultant primarily to neurologists and neurosurgeons. The neuropathologist is knowledgeable in the infirmities of humans as they affect the nervous and neuromuscular systems, be they degenerative, infectious, metabolic, immunologic, neoplastic, vascular or physical in nature.
